Pros

Company is committed to health Company provides opportunity to make a real difference in what people eat High ethical standards Senior leaders listen to nutrition scientists Company has improved healthfulness of many products Pays more than any other job for dietitians

Cons

The Bell Institute is an "unusual" function at General Mills so many colleagues understand our role and may not appreciate the value we provide We work harder than people in other jobs -- longer hours, higher quality work expected Because there aren't many places for us to work in the company, we might not have as many promotion opportunities as product developers or marketers
